30 Hour Funding
The Government introduced new funding to allow childcare providers to offer 30 hours free childcare to working parents. All 3 and 4 year old's are already entitled to 15 hours of free childcare a week and this additional 15 hours will be on offer to families where both parents are working (or the sole parent is working in a lone-parent family), and each parent earns the equivalent of 16 hours a week at the national minimum or living wage, and earns less than £100,000 a year.
To find out more information on 30 hours childcare, how to check you eligibility and how to apply, please click HERE.
Our nursery will continue to offer 26 full time places. (No part time.)
Parents/Carers will need to provide funding for the additional 15 hours by either providing proof of their 30 hour entitlement, or paying for the additional 15 hours which are over and above the centrally-funded 15 hours.
